Abstract

The most frequent primary tumour of the heart is myxoma, followed by lipoma, rhabdomyoma, haemangioma and lymphangioma. Primary tumors of the heart constitute 0.4% of autopsy specimens. We report a case of 40 years male who died suddenly and his heart was received in Pathology Department for examination. In the left ventricular wall, a well circumscribed yellowish mass was seen which on microscopy proved to be a lipoma.
